Gordha - Rasulpur, Jajpur
Gordha is a village situated in the Rasulpur tehsil of Jajpur district, Odisha. It is located approximately 6 km from Kuakhia and around 22 km from Jajapur . Badakainchi serves as the Gram Panchayat for Gordha village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Gordha is 401521. The village covers a total geographical area of 49 hectares and falls under the 755009 pincode. Jajapur is the nearest town, located about 24 km away.
Gordha village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Korei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Jajpur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Gordha
According to the 2011 Census, Gordha village had a total population of 816 people, including 432 males and 384 females, living in 159 households. The sex ratio was 889 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 90.43%, with male literacy at 97.24% and female literacy at 82.77%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 238,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 4.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 816 | 432 | 384 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 64 | 34 | 30 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 238 | 132 | 106 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 4 | 3 | 1 |
| Literate Population | 680 | 387 | 293 |
| Illiterate Population | 136 | 45 | 91 |

Transport and Connectivity of Gordha
Gordha is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
